Egg freezing, medically known as oocyte cryopreservation, is the process of stimulating a woman's ovaries to produce multiple mature eggs, retrieving those eggs under light sedation, and then flash-freezing them using a technique called vitrification. This preserves the eggs in a biologically paused state until the woman is ready to use them, at which point they are thawed, fertilised with sperm, and transferred as embryos.

The Step-by-Step Egg Freezing Process Explained

Understanding each phase of the egg freezing journey helps demystify the process and reduces anxiety for first-time patients in Vatika City.

Step 1 — Initial Consultation and Testing: Your journey begins with a comprehensive fertility assessment. The HomeIVF Medical Board coordinates blood hormone tests (AMH, FSH, LH, estradiol) and an antral follicle count via transvaginal ultrasound to evaluate your ovarian reserve. This can be coordinated at a diagnostic centre close to Vatika City on Sohna Road.

Step 2 — Ovarian Stimulation: Over 10 to 14 days, you self-administer hormonal injections (gonadotropins) to stimulate your ovaries to produce multiple eggs. HomeIVF's care coordinators train you on injection technique during a home visit and monitor your progress through scheduled ultrasound scans.

Step 3 — Trigger Injection: Once follicles reach the desired size, a trigger injection (typically hCG or a GnRH agonist) is administered to finalise egg maturation, approximately 36 hours before retrieval.

Step 4 — Egg Retrieval: This minimally invasive procedure is performed under light sedation at a partner clinical facility in Gurgaon. Eggs are retrieved transvaginally using ultrasound guidance. The procedure takes roughly 20 to 30 minutes.

Step 5 — Vitrification and Storage: Retrieved mature eggs are flash-frozen using vitrification technology and stored in a liquid nitrogen tank. HomeIVF coordinates with accredited storage facilities that comply with ICMR guidelines.

Step 6 — Future Use: When you are ready, the eggs are thawed, fertilised via ICSI (intracytoplasmic sperm injection), and the resulting embryos are transferred to your uterus in a subsequent cycle.

One of the most common questions from women in Vatika City is simply: when should I freeze my eggs? The answer is grounded in reproductive biology. A woman is born with her lifetime supply of eggs, and both the number and quality of those eggs decline with age — accelerating noticeably after 35. Freezing eggs before this threshold meaningfully improves future success rates.

Women aged 25 to 30 typically have the highest ovarian reserve and the best egg quality, making this the ideal window. Women aged 30 to 35 still have excellent outcomes, though slightly higher stimulation doses may be required. After 37, while freezing is still possible and beneficial in many cases, the number of eggs retrieved per cycle and their developmental potential may be lower.

Medical conditions are another driver. Women diagnosed with PCOS, endometriosis, early-onset diminished ovarian reserve, or those about to undergo chemotherapy or radiation should consider egg freezing urgently, regardless of age.

How many eggs should I freeze to have a good chance of pregnancy later?+

Most fertility specialists recommend aiming for 10 to 15 mature eggs to maximise future success rates. However, the number of eggs retrieved per cycle depends on your ovarian reserve and age. Some women may require more than one stimulation cycle to reach their target number. The HomeIVF Medical Board will set a personalised egg target based on your AMH level and antral follicle count.

Can I freeze my eggs if I have PCOS and live in Vatika City?+

Yes. Women with PCOS often have a higher antral follicle count and may respond very well to ovarian stimulation. However, PCOS also increases the risk of ovarian hyperstimulation syndrome (OHSS), so careful protocol selection is essential. The HomeIVF Medical Board adjusts stimulation protocols for PCOS patients to minimise this risk while maximising mature egg yield. A full hormonal assessment is done before starting.

Is egg freezing painful? What is the recovery like?+

Most women describe the stimulation phase as manageable, with mild bloating or mood changes from hormonal injections. The retrieval procedure is performed under light sedation, so you will not feel pain during it. Post-retrieval, mild cramping and bloating are common for one to two days. Most HomeIVF patients in Vatika City return to work within 24 to 48 hours of retrieval, depending on their individual response.

What is the difference between egg freezing and embryo freezing in Gurgaon?+

Egg freezing preserves unfertilised eggs, giving single women full autonomy over future decisions about fertilisation. Embryo freezing involves fertilising eggs with a partner's or donor's sperm before freezing, which is common for couples. Both techniques use vitrification and have comparable survival rates.
